Introduction

In a bid to get her revenge on her true love, Nimah let the monster inside her take over unleashing powers she had no idea of. Stuck between two men, she has to settle for one. Love, commitment and friendship helps her on her journey of finding out what she is really capable of.
Who will Nimah choose? Will she ever forgive the son of the man whom murdered her Father? Will she love him regardless? Or will she pick the other?.

Chapter 1

Nimah stared at the stranger's back as he faced the direction of the burning sun, his right hand stroking and playing with the yellow flowers in the garden. His black hair curled and wet. His shoulder broad and strong. He had on a black Trouser sew with a suit material and a Blue and White striped Vintage Shirt. She could see his feet from afar and noticed he had no sandals on.

Was he comfortable that way? Was he not bothered?.

Feeling the hotness of the sun on her skin made her want to run back inside and take shelter, probably jump into a pool full of cold clean water or a bathtub.

She walked closer to him, her long Brown waist length hair dancing in rhythm with the cool breeze blowing on her cheeks. She could feel the excitement building up inside of her and the adrenaline running through her vein.

She heard giggling from afar, a little girl giggling but she couldn't see the person nor where the sound came from.

Was it her giggling? Was it someone else?.

She wasn't sure about anything but what she knew was that she was happy, so happy that she wanted to stay that way forever.

" Where is that little brat?." Her Father yelled from afar as he stormed up the stairs causing her to wake up from her dream.

Her neck ached, her cheek swollen from the constant beating and her eyes red from non stop tears. She looked around her to find herself still in the dark abandoned basement with cobwebs and insects around. She was used to the bad smell oozing from the dead rat that laid in the corner of the room. She stared down at the Barbie doll that was lying right beside her, her once long full hair, scanty and dirty. Her Pink dress tore and dirty. She picked up Pula and held it close to her heart, it was what she had named it. Pula was all she had, her only true friend and the only one whom stood by her during the rough days. She had gotten Pula for her First birthday from her parents before everything had changed.

" Where the hell is that little brat?. " He yelled again. She could hear the anger in his voice and wondered what she had done this time.

" That little wench is in the basement. " She heard her elder brother Nad say with a hint of mockery in his voice.

The door pushed open, she could see his figure from where she hid, beads of sweat running down her forehead, her heart beating so fast like it would jump out of her body. She was sure he had the long leash with him as always.

She could hear him groan as he closed the door, trying to find her out in the dark.

" Come out you little witch." He screamed angrily and scattered all the empty boxes that he knew she could hide behind.

" Come out now." He screamed loudly. The realization of her trying to outsmart him angered him.

If she provoked him for too long, he might hurt her the more.

Her heart skipped.

The dark should save her, that she hoped.

She placed her palm over her mouth, trying to stop her silent sobs from being heard. She silently prayed that he leave soon. Her back ached badly from the last beating. She was too uncomfortable that she had to rest it. Moving backward a little, she rested against the White deep freezer and had not noticed the small vase on it.

Gbam!.

It fell.

She gasped immediately. She knew nothing could save her now as he ran towards her and dragged her out of the stacked cartons in front of it.

" Got you!." He yelled happily like he had won a gift and pulled her hair backward, laughing hysterically.

" So...sorry...Father." She sobbed pleadingly. She was used to the non stop regular beating she received everyday even though some days she hoped he would love and care for her just like he did seventeen years ago.

" Shut up!." He ordered and landed the leash on her making her scream. She dare not make a loud sound so he would not hit her the more. She sunk her fingers into her thin pale lap as she gnashed her teeth, trying to hold the pain back.

" I thought I told you never to come out during the day." He said eyeing her badly, striking an angry pose.

" Y....Ye...Yes Father. " She stammered, scared. She knew she had gotten in trouble the moment she had broken the rule. Nad had personally walked up to her to inform her that their Father had gone out. He had said she was free to come out and eat since she had being so hungry, starved for days. Being gullible, he had deceived her and she had trusted him, her own brother. Getting out, she realized that there was no food made for her and it was all a scheme to land her in trouble. If only she had insisted that he bring in the food, maybe she would have avoided the day's beating.

" I should have discarded you a long time ago." He said and dragged her hair, her neck visible.

She saw his eyes turn red and her lips went dry. It was time, time for his monster self to show up. She bit her lips as he bent and sank his fang into her neck, sucking her aggressively. She felt her strength leaving, her body getting weaker, her lids closing. She had to stay awake, had to be strong. She bit her lips harder till she tasted her blood, tears running down her eyes.

Someone save me!.

Someone save me please!.

She sobbed till everything went blank.

~~~~~~~

Nimah closed her eyes forcefully as her head banged so hard, aching so badly. She endured the cold effect the bare floor had on her back, she needed it to cool her sore back for the meantime.

A tear dropped from her right eye as she cursed her bad fate.

Why wasn't her life as simple as that of Nad? Why did everything have to be so tough on her?.

A soft tap landed on the door before it was pushed open. She instantly knew it was her Mother Lisa, she was the only one whom knocked. According to her, she dreaded seeing Nimah naked, said it would cause her bad luck too.

She heard the sound of the tray as Lisa pushed it forward and stepped out, closing the door behind her.

Nimah waited till she heard the door close before getting up in order not to provoke Lisa. The day she had rushed for the food while Lisa was still there, she was severely punished, beaten and cut open with the rusty razor blades that laid in a part of the basement. She took a deep breath and crawled towards the tray of food, she was too weak to walk.

She stared at the bowl of watery Ginger soup and scooped some into her mouth. It had absolutely no taste and was so peppery. Her tongue stung as it landed on it but she didn't let that discourage her from drinking the whole bowl. Whatever opportunity she saw to eat, she used well cause who knows when next she would taste anything.

The hotness she felt on her tongue and throat was too much, it felt like her whole body was been set on fire. There was no water jar in the tray nor was there any around. She knew she had to step out and get some water or she could cough to death.

Don't, Nimah.

Something warned her or was it her scared self.

She understood what it felt. She would end up being beaten if caught outside the basement but she had to take the risk. She stretched her hand and picked the Brown dirty scarf lying on one of the cartons and wrapped it around her head. It was to cover her hair and stop it from falling down or leaving some traces behind. Most times her hair fell out in small quantity and sometimes big ones. She was used to it already and fine with it but littering the house with her hair could cause her more punishment. If no one might see her till she was back then why leave traces behind.

She coughed for a while and tried to maintain her balance before getting stepping out of the room. Opening and closing the door slowly so it wouldn't make any loud sound.

She tiptoed as she walked up the stairs, heading for the dining table on the left hand corner of the apartment.

She stared at the well arranged apartment and the new paintings added to the wall. She couldn't even remember the last time she had seen the walls of the house. Everything looked well furnished and painted. She walked towards the dining and picked up a clean towel on one of the chairs before holding the water jar with it. She looked around for her Yellow cup but couldn't find it.

Had they disposed of it? She knew it was something they could do. What was she going to do now? How was she suppose to drink any water?.
